Summary
Western Digital Corporation (WDC) reported its fiscal second quarter and year-to-date results for the period ending December 28, 2012. The company experienced a significant revenue increase of 92% year-over-year for the quarter and 68% for the six-month period, largely driven by the acquisition of Hitachi Global Storage Technologies (HGST). This acquisition significantly expanded WDC's market presence and product portfolio. While revenue surged, gross margin as a percentage of revenue decreased year-over-year for the quarter, influenced by the prior year's artificially high margins due to Thailand flood-related supply constraints. Operating expenses also increased due to the inclusion of HGST's operations and ongoing investments in R&D. Despite these factors, operating income saw a substantial increase due to the scale of the acquired business. The company also initiated a quarterly cash dividend policy and continued its share repurchase program, signaling a focus on returning capital to shareholders.

Key Highlights
- 1Net revenue for the second quarter increased by 92% to $3.8 billion compared to the prior-year period, primarily due to the HGST acquisition.
- 2Total hard drive unit shipments for the quarter increased by 108% to 59.2 million units.
- 3Gross margin percentage decreased to 27.7% in the quarter from 32.5% in the prior-year period, impacted by normalized industry supply conditions post-Thailand floods.
- 4Operating income increased significantly to $478 million, up from $162 million in the prior year, reflecting the scale of the combined entity.
- 5R&D expenses nearly doubled to $378 million for the quarter, driven by the inclusion of HGST's operations and continued investment.
- 6The company generated $1.7 billion in net cash from operating activities for the six-month period, demonstrating strong operational cash flow.
- 7Western Digital initiated a quarterly cash dividend policy and continued its share repurchase program, returning capital to shareholders.
